Abstract

Unit Rawat Jalan RSU Puri Raharja merupakan salah satu pelayanan kesehatan yang disediakan oleh RSU Puri Raharja. Unit Rawat Jalan RSU Puri Raharja berlokasi di Jalan W.R. Supratman, dimana jalan tersebut merupakan jalan kolektor yang memiliki kinerja ruas jalan yang cukup padat. Dengan adanya operasional dari Unit Rawat Jalan RSU Puri Raharja ini tentukan memberikan pengaruh terhadap kinerja lalu lintas di sekitarnya, yaitu Jalan W.R. Supratman dan Jalan Gadung. Dari hasil analisis didapatkan bahwa Jalan W.R. Supratman pergerakan terpadat pada hari kerja terjadi pada pukul 17.00 – 18.00 WITA dengan volume lalu lintas sebesar 2598,2 smp/jam. Volume lalu lintas Jalan Gadung pada hari kerja, jam puncak terjadi pada pukul 12.15 – 13.15 WITA dengan volume lalu lintas sebesar 445,0 smp/jam. Kinerja Jalan W.R. Supratman yang berada di depan lokasi Unit Rawat Jalan RSU Puri Raharja yang terkena dampak langsung dari operasional tersebut. Jalan W.R. Supratman pada jam puncak saat hari kerja memiliki V/C ratio sebesar 0,83. Jumlah bangkitan dan tarikan yang ditimbulkan sebesar 54,4 smp/jam. Kondisi eksisting merupakan kondisi saat ini dimana Unit Rawat Jalan RSU Puri Raharja telah beroperasi. Dengan adanya operasional Unit Rawat Jalan RSU Puri Raharja tersebut berdampak sebesar 2,09% terhadap kinerja lalu lintas di Jalan W.R. Supratman pada kondisi eksisting.

Abstract

Project planning is the first step in managing the resources, funds and time that has been determined to complete the project. The project for the construction of the Mpu Kuturan Singaraja State Hindu Religious High School Flat is a project that has been implemented but does not have an existing plan yet. Therefore, the author tries to make a plan according to the method that has been studied. This plan consists of a Construction Project Implementation Method Plan, a Project Implementation Schedule Plan using the Precedence Diagram Method (PDM), an Implementation Cost Plan (RBP), a Cost Budget Plan (RAB), and a Achievement Schedule with the S Curve Method.

Abstract

Activities at school have a direct impact on traffic, especially during school hours. Side obstacles that worsen road performance and increase delays, along with vehicle entry and exit activities to or from school, disrupt traffic performance. While the presence of rise and pull is not a cause of decreased road performance, behavior that does not comply with traffic signs often is. This research uses data collection techniques by direct observation to gather the necessary data at the research site. This observation was carried out directly and lasted for one day to obtain road geometric data, traffic volume, side obstacle data, speed, and trip generation data. Changes were observed in vehicles leaving and heading to SMP Negeri 1 Blahbatuh during the survey time. The magnitude ranged from 0.8 second/hour to 173.8 second/hour. The low conditions occurred between 08.45-09.45 and the highest conditions between 06.30-07.30. The peak time for the departure or arrival of vehicles at SMP Negeri 1 Blahbatuh is 06.30-07.30. When SMP Negeri 1 Blahbatuh operates during peak hours, the traffic volume is less than when it is not operating. It is known that the saturation level fell by 27.39%, traffic volume fell by 1.19%, and road capacity remained unchanged. It is also known that at the peak of trip generation there was a decrease in traffic volume by 10.51%, an increase in road capacity by 4.45%, and a decrease in saturation levels by 29.33% when SMP Negeri 1 Blahbatuh was operating compared to when it was not operating.
